RésuméLa présente loi établit un cadre juridique pour la protection des données à caractère personnel en Eswatini. Elle crée une autorité de contrôle indépendante, définit les droits des personnes concernées et impose des obligations aux responsables de traitement. La loi s'applique à tout traitement de données effectué sur le territoire national ou concernant des résidents d'Eswatini.

# AN ACT ENTITLED

AN ACT to provide for the collection, processing, disclosure and protection of personal data; balancing competing values of personal information privacy and sector-specific laws and other related matters.

ENACTED by the King and the Parliament of Eswatini.
